Several issues fixed:
 - We were missing a bunch of feature lists. Fix this by simply dumping
   the meta list feature_word_info.
 - kvm_enabled() cannot be true at this point because accelerators are
   initialized much later during init. Also, hiding this makes it very
   hard to discover for users. Simply dump unconditionally if CONFIG_KVM
   is set.
 - Add explanation for "host" CPU type.

Signed-off-by: Jan Kiszka <address@hidden>
---

Changes in v2:
 - Do not dump "host" type if CONFIG_KVM is not set
 - Explain that "host" depends on KVM mode
